What are the zeros of the function
f(x) = x2 - 11x + 24?

The middle term of -11x can be split into -8x and -3x
We thus get the equation:
x^2-8x-3x+24
x(x-8)-3(x-8)
(x-3)(x-8)
Thus the zeroes are +3 and +8.
